How to Become a Butchers and Meat Cutters in Florida

Butchers and Meat Cutters in Florida earn a median salary of $42,790/year, which is 7% above the national average. Florida has no state income tax. After taxes and rent, a butchers and meat cutters takes home approximately $1,012/month. Most positions require High school diploma or equivalent.

Butchers and Meat Cutters salary by metro area in Florida

Metro areaMedianHourlyEmployment
Naples-Marco Island$47K$22.4/hr260
Palm Bay-Melbourne-Titusville$46K$22.35/hr260
North Port-Bradenton-Sarasota$46K$22.29/hr500
Crestview-Fort Walton Beach-Destin$46K$22.08/hr170
Orlando-Kissimmee-Sanford$46K$21.95/hr1,080
Cape Coral-Fort Myers$45K$21.86/hr420
Tampa-St. Petersburg-Clearwater$45K$21.74/hr1,320
Homosassa Springs$45K$21.57/hr40
Sebastian-Vero Beach-West Vero Corridor$44K$21.34/hr110
Port St. Lucie$44K$21.21/hr230
Punta Gorda$44K$21.18/hr110
Deltona-Daytona Beach-Ormond Beach$44K$20.92/hr290
Gainesville$43K$20.9/hr160
Jacksonville$42K$20.24/hr750
Wildwood-The Villages$41K$19.77/hr80

Frequently asked questions

How much does a butchers and meat cutters make in Florida?

The median butchers and meat cutters salary in Florida is $42,790 per year ($20.57/hr). This is 7% above the national median of $40,140. Salaries range from $29,640 to $49,160.

What are the requirements to become a butchers and meat cutters in Florida?

Butchers and Meat Cutters positions in Florida typically require High school diploma or equivalent. Florida may have specific licensing or certification requirements. Check with the Florida licensing board or department of labor for current requirements.

Can a butchers and meat cutters afford to live in Florida?

At the median salary of $42,790, a butchers and meat cutters in Florida would take home approximately $3,035/month after taxes. With median 2-bedroom rent at $2,023/month, that's 66.7% of take-home pay going to housing. This exceeds the recommended 30% guideline.

What are the best cities for butchers and meat cutters in Florida?

The highest paying metro areas for butchers and meat cutters in Florida are Naples-Marco Island ($46,580), Palm Bay-Melbourne-Titusville ($46,480), North Port-Bradenton-Sarasota ($46,350). However, cost of living varies significantly between metros, a higher salary may not mean more purchasing power.
